    I recently transferred all my Avios to nectar (because of the devaluation) and then promptly had them all stolen (who knew thieves could just generate randon numbers on their app to empty Nectar accounts without any security instore whatsoever?) and even went ‘overdrawn’.

    Nectar setup a new account and restored all my points, but I couldn’t relink my BA account as it was already linked to the (now locked) previous account. This couldn’t be unlinked, either by me or Nectar, because it was now permanently locked (talk about after the hores bolted!).

    Nectar couldn’t help at all but I managed to Unlink and Re-link on the BA site and transfer them all back successfully from the BA side.

    Solved. BA told me that the system “didn’t like” my email address [which I have had since Gmail started and has been my BA email contatct for 12 years….] so I’ve had to change it. I’ve also therefore had to change the email at Nectar. All works now. No idea why BA took a dislike to my original email, perhaps it was listed on some ‘black list’ or something.     Its not thieves generating random numbers though?

    Indeed. The thieves already know the first sets of digits and the modulus check to filter out definitely wrong numbers.

    They often have the benefit of people choosing not to collect the printed discount vouchers from the colour receipt printers that also have a section of Nectar IDs on the voucher. Likewise “Would you like a receipt” (with Nectar balance) still on the pumps as the individual drives off.
